Job Goal:
To provide individualized or small group educational assistance and support to Spanish immersion students keeping accurate records, administering placement tests, providing accommodations for required state assessments, administering the annual Language Proficiency tests, facilitating student engagement and attendance all with the purpose of improving student achievement.

Qualifications:
Associate or b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in a related field
Bilingual and work experience with Spanish language learners preferred but not required.
3.Related work experience is preferred but not required.
4.Exceptional ability to build and maintain effective working relationships and interact professionally with others.
5.Demonstrated ability to use good judgment, follow through on assigned tasks and maintain confidentiality.
Essential Functions:
Within established school or department procedural guidelines, the incumbent performs fundamental bilingual classroom support functions to assist students, teachers, and program staff in meeting District goals, policies, and governmental agency regulations.
